A Ball Valve is The most commonly acknowledged valves in fluid valves tech as a consequence of its simplicity and efficiency. It uses a spherical disc to manage stream. Once the ball’s hole is aligned With all the flow, the valve is open; when turned ninety levels by the handle or actuator, the opening is perpendicular towards the stream path, halting the circulation totally. This quick quarter-switch operation and restricted sealing capacity make the Ball Valve perfect for on/off control without force drop. It is actually greatly used in pipelines where by minimum leakage and quick shut-off are required. Also, the Ball Valve is sturdy and performs very well even after quite a few cycles, which makes it a preferred selection in each domestic and industrial apps.
In distinction, the Gate Valve operates by lifting a gate away from The trail on the fluid. It's mainly made for entire open or complete close functions and isn't suited to stream regulation. Certainly one of the advantages of using a Gate Valve in fluid valves tech units is its nominal strain drop when absolutely open, as being the gate absolutely clears the movement route. This makes it ideal for purposes in which a straight-line move of fluid and bare minimum movement restriction is sought after. Gate Valves are generally Employed in water provide units, wastewater treatment method vegetation, and system plants in which rare operation is anticipated.
The World Valve is an additional critical component in fluid valves tech. It's made to control stream within a pipeline, consisting of the movable disk-variety component and also a stationary ring seat within a typically spherical body. The Globe Valve provides fantastic throttling capabilities and is also utilised the place circulation Handle is critical. This valve’s capability to exactly Regulate stream causes it to be ideal for applications which include cooling drinking water techniques, fuel oil units, and chemical feed devices. Even so, a result of the tortuous path the fluid ought to get with the valve, it ordeals a lot more pressure fall than Ball or Gate Valves.
Verify Valves, also known as non-return valves, are important in stopping backflow inside of a technique. They permit fluid to movement in just one direction and mechanically close if circulation reverses. This is especially crucial in fluid valves tech where by preserving unidirectional move is crucial to safeguard pumps, compressors, as well as other products from damage attributable to reverse stream. Check Valves are available in several types which includes swing Test, carry check, and dual plate kinds, Every single suited for various apps dependant on flow price and strain problems.
The Butterfly Valve is an additional commonly made use of valve key in fashionable fluid valves tech. This valve features a rotating disc that regulates the flow of fluid. A important benefit of the Butterfly Valve is its compact design and low excess weight, making it suitable for large diameter pipes and installations where House is proscribed. With a quarter-change operation, the valve is easy to work manually or by having an actuator. It is usually used in h2o distribution, HVAC programs, and chemical providers. Although it would not present precisely the same tight shutoff for a Ball Valve, its effectiveness in throttling and cost-performance ensure it is a practical alternative in many apps.
An frequently missed but crucial ingredient of fluid valves tech would be the Strainer. A Strainer is used to filter out debris and particles within the fluid ahead of it enters delicate gear like pumps, meters, or valves. By eradicating solids, Strainers shield your complete fluid method from problems, decrease upkeep prices, and boost operational effectiveness. There are different types of Strainers for instance Y-strainers and basket strainers, each supplying several amounts of filtration and suitable for particular strain and stream disorders. They're An important element in keeping cleanse fluid devices in industries which include prescription drugs, food processing, and petrochemicals.
To enhance the automation and control abilities of fluid units, Actuators Participate in A necessary job. An Actuator is usually a mechanical machine that moves or controls a system or technique. In fluid valves tech, Actuators are accustomed to open or shut valves remotely. They may be driven electrically, pneumatically, or hydraulically. By integrating an Actuator using a valve, operators can automate processes, improve precision, and remove the need for handbook intervention. Actuators are specially precious in massive-scale operations which include oil refineries, chemical crops, and water treatment services in which handbook operation is impractical or unsafe. Additionally, Actuators is usually integrated with sensors and control devices for true-time checking and remote diagnostics.
